Biography
Caoimhe is a research assistant psychologist with the Department of General Practice, School of Medicine at NUI Galway. She has a B.Sc. in Psychology from the University of Limerick and an M.Sc. in Health Psychology from NUIG.Caoimhe has a strong interest in health services research, particularly in relation to patient safety and behaviour change within the context of the medical profession.She iscurrently working on a number of projects concerned with examining behaviour and identifying error in patient care, with the overriding aim of improving patient safety outcomesand enhancing healthcare professionals performance.
